    Job Summary:

    The Vice President of Supply Chain Management will play a critical role in overseeing and optimizing the end-to-end supply chain processes within CNE.

    • This strategic leadership position requires a seasoned professional with a proven track record in supply chain management, logistics, and procurement, particularly within the healthcare industry.
    • The successful candidate will drive ef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and innovation in the supply chain to support the organization's mission of delivering outstanding patient care.

    Duties and Responsibilities:

    Strategic Leadership:

    Develop and execute the overall supply chain strategy aligned with organizational goals and objectives.

    Lead and mentor a high-performing supply chain team, fostering a culture of coll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ement.

    Supply Chain Optimization:

    Implement best practices in supply chain management to enhance operational efficiency.

    Identify opportunities for cost savings, process improvements, and supply chain innovation.

    Procurement and Vendor Management:

    Oversee the procurement process, ensuring the sourcing of high-quality goods and services at competitive prices.

    Establish and maintain strong relationships with vendors and negotiate favorable contracts.

    Logistics and Distribution:

    Manage the logistics and distribution network to ensure timely and accurate delivery of supplies to various healthcare facilities.

    Optimize transportation and warehousing strategies to reduce costs and improve service levels.

    Compliance and Risk Management:

    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ements related to supply chain activities.

    Develop and implement risk management strategies to mitigate supply chain disruptions.

    Technology Integration:

    Leverage technology and data analytics to enhance visibility and decision-making within the supply chain.

    Identify and implement emerging technologies to drive innovation in supply chain processes.

    Requirements:

    •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or a related field; Master's degree preferred.
    • Proven experience in a senior-level supply chain management role within the healthcare industry.
    • Strong understanding of healthcare supply chain regulations and compliance requirements.
    • Demonstrated ability to lead and develop high-performing teams.
    • Excellent negotiation, communication, and relationship-building skills.
    • Strategic thinker with a results-oriented mindset.

    Care New England Health System (CNE) and its member institutions; Butler Hospital, Women & Infants Hospital, Kent Hospital, VNA of Care New England, Integra, The Providence Center, and Care New England Medical Group, and our Wellness Center, are trusted organizations fueling the latest advances in medical research, attracting top specialty-trained doctors, and honing renowned services and innovative programs to engage in the important discussions people need to have about their health.
